Output 8e6baa1821951362cf61bea094b01633c2709e49ce0df085b879e80531010873:0

value
11494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b40afed7a9192ec549e67efacc15883be694839 OP_EQUAL
address
3LDib2orsYBT9qzm3Pt3G6pENQ1Akfj8B5
transaction
8e6baa1821951362cf61bea094b01633c2709e49ce0df085b879e80531010873
spent
true